Question to the Department of Health and Social Care:

To ask the Secretary of State for Heath and Social Care, what recent assessment he has made of the adequacy of the capacity of the secure hospital system in England and Wales.

NHS England and NHS Improvement haveconducted a demand and capacity review of adult medium and low secure services to ensure they are in the right geographical location and delivering the right type of service in a timely way. This fed into the commitment to use National Health Service-led provider collaboratives to get appropriate, high quality secure care in place, which is being delivered as part of the implementation of the NHS Long Term Plan.

For high secure services, NHS England and NHS Improvement are in the early stages of a similar demand and capacity review as part of strategic commissioning work. This has been delayed due to the COVID-19 restrictions but is expected to inform the workplan for the 2021-26 high secure demand and capacity plan.

NHS England and NHS Improvement are working with stakeholders to explore and model what impact COVID-19 might have on future demand and capacity in the adult secure estate.
